Who Qualifies for the New SASSA Payment Increase

SASSA Grant Eligibility for December 2025 To receive the December 2025 SASSA increase you must meet the same requirements that apply to current grants. You need to be a South African citizen or permanent resident or a refugee with proper documents. The Old Age Grant requires you to be at least 60 years old. Parents with children under 18 years old can apply for the Child Support Grant. Your income must fall within the limits that SASSA sets to keep the system fair. You should check your status on the official SASSA website or visit your local office before payment dates. This helps prevent delays or problems with your payments.

How to Check Your SASSA Grant Status and Payment Dates

Beneficiaries can check their SASSA payment status online by visiting the agency’s official website or by using their registered phone number. The system shows when payments will arrive and how much money will be deposited into their bank accounts for each grant. People who don’t have internet can use a USSD service to check their grant details quickly. SASSA usually sends out payments during the first week of December so that beneficiaries get their money on time to cover their monthly costs without running into financial problems.
